AI Transparency Report

Tofte Lake Center demonstrates a generally stable financial position with consistent growth in revenue and assets over the past decade. In the latest filing period (202312), the organization reported revenue of $270,494 against expenses of $355,453, indicating a deficit for the year. However, this follows a strong surplus in 202212 where revenue was $316,460 and expenses were $244,384. The organization's assets have steadily increased from $238,801 in 2014 to $344,594 in 2023, suggesting prudent financial management over the long term. Liabilities remain very low, at $3,785 in 2023, which is a positive indicator of financial health and low debt burden. The organization's transparency is excellent, as evidenced by 13 filings and consistent reporting of zero officer compensation, which is a strong positive for a nonprofit of this size. While the 2023 deficit is notable, it appears to be an anomaly in a trend of overall growth and sound asset management. Filing History

IRS 990 filing history for Tofte Lake Center showing financial trends over 13 years of public records:

Over 13 years of IRS 990 filings (2011–2023), Tofte Lake Center's revenue has grown by 250.1%, moving from $77K to $270K. Total assets increased by 197.8% over the same period, from $116K to $345K. Total functional expenses rose by 584.9%, from $52K to $355K. In its most recent filing year (2023), Tofte Lake Center reported a deficit of $85K, with expenses exceeding revenue. The organization holds $4K in liabilities against $345K in assets (debt-to-asset ratio: 1.1%), resulting in net assets of $341K.
